What is Laminate Flooring?
Laminate flooring consists of several layers fused together through a lamination process. The core layer is usually made of high-density fiberboard (HDF) that provides strength and durability. Above this is a photographic layer that mimics the appearance of natural wood or stone, topped with a clear protective layer that resists scratches, stains, and wear. Unlike hardwood, which is made from harvested wood, laminate is a composite material that offers a realistic look with added durability.
History of Laminate Flooring
Originating in Europe in the 1970s, laminate flooring was developed as an affordable alternative to real hardwood and stone floors. Over the decades, advancements in technology have enhanced its design capabilities, making it a versatile and sought-after flooring choice worldwide. Innovations in high-definition printing and texturing have allowed laminate to closely mimic various natural materials, making it a go-to option for those seeking style and practicality.
Advantages and Benefits of Laminate Flooring
Laminate flooring offers numerous advantages, making it a smart choice for many households and commercial spaces.
Durability and Longevity
Laminate is renowned for its strength and resistance to scratches, dents, and fading. It holds up well in high-traffic areas, making it ideal for busy households and commercial environments. Its durability also extends its lifespan. View some of our most durable laminate options.
Cost-Effectiveness
One of the most appealing aspects of laminate flooring is its cost-effectiveness. It provides the luxurious look of hardwood or stone at a fraction of the price. Additionally, its durability and ease of maintenance can lead to long-term savings.
